I spent a year at KCET learning how to dig through archives to build a story. After that stint I went back to grad school at the UCLA film school and started to put what I'd learned into practice on my stories. One of the things I'd found was that we'd lost track of over 100 sites where we'd dumped nuclear waste into the ocean. This finding shocked the EPA, that was being tasked with supporting the Reagan administrations desires to renew the dumping of nuclear waste. My research put a spanner in their desire to start dumping in the Mariana Trench. Congressman John Burton, held hearings and journalists like Bettina Gregory started to jump on aspects of the story. We had to get the underwater footage to her in New York. My friend at ABC in LA, Susan Cope got us up on the satellite feed and we made the deadline. The Congressional hearings revolved around the government saying dumping was safe and other saying, if we don't know what happened in the past how can you be sure it's be safe in the future. They won the argument and the resumption of the ocean disposal of nuclear waste was stopped in this country. This decision triggered the London Dumping Convention to outlaw dumping globally.
As I.F. Stone found out, there's gold in them thar public records.
